“Superintelligence: Paths, Dangers, Strategies” by Nick Bostrom is a textbook published by Oxford University Press that delves into the subject area of artificial intelligence. The book explores the potential for computers to surpass human intelligence and the implications of this development, discussing the risks and benefits associated with superintelligent systems. With 432 pages, this trade paperback offers a comprehensive examination of the complexities surrounding AI and semantics, making it a valuable resource for those interested in the field of computer science and its impact on society.
